United pilot suspended after London arrest

By Jerry Limone

United said it suspended a pilot who was arrested at London's Heathrow Airport on Monday on suspicion of being drunk before the plane took off for Chicago.

United said it suspended the pilot, Erwin Washington, pending a full investigation. Washington is scheduled to appear in a London court on Nov. 20.

The flight was canceled, and the 124 passengers were transferred to other flights.
